REPUBLIC ACT NO. 2210 - AN ACT PROVINDING FOR THE CREATION OF AN ADDITIONAL POSITION OF MUNICIPAL JUDGE FOR THE CITY OF CAVITE, AMENDING FOR THE PURPOSE SECTION SEVENTY-FOUR OF COMMONWEALTH ACT NUMBERED FIVE HUNDRED FORTY-SEVEN.
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ives of the Philippines in Congress assembled:
SECTION 1. The first paragraph of section seventy-four of Commonwealth Act Numbered Five hundred forty-seven, otherwise known as the Charter of the City of Cavite, is amended to read as follows:
"SEC. 74. Regular, auxiliary and acting judges of municipal court. —There shall be a municipal court for the City of Cavite, for which two municipal judges and an auxiliary municipal judge shall be appointed." SEC. 2. This Act shall take effect upon its approval.
Approved, May 15, 1959.
